Principal Stresses and Strains:
Principal Stresses and Strains is a very important link in the analysis of solids so as to make sure safe design of different components of structures or machines or other systems. Here, you were exposed to a deeper insight into the implications of a specified state of stress. You have study how to evaluate the stress components on different planes and also to discover the extreme values of stress components. Additionally, a cursory treatment of the methods of establishing the state of stress in simple cases of joint loading is also provided. This study must be helpful in understanding a specified loading situation and its bearing on the strength of solid involved.
At last, an introductory treatment of different failure theories has been provided with appropriate illustrative examples of analysis and design. Correctly, we have come to the close of Block 1 which undertakes a treatment of easy cases of stresses & strains on simple members.
Now, you are armed along the knowledge & skill adequate enough for undertaking a study of more difficult systems of structures & developing the capability for designing such systems, an activity which might be considered as backbone of engineering field.
